INFORMATION The bidder will design, supply and deliver 02 nos. cutter suction Dredgers, in such a manner that they will be rugged, to withstand tough marine condition that prevails along the entire Coast of Maharashtra. The dredgers capacity should be as detailed in the technical specification. The area of operation will be rivers, estuaries, minor ports, fishing harbour, coastal areas and sheltered waters. The dredgers will be used for dredging various materials under water so as to dump it at 500 met through pipelines. The dredger machine shall be capable to dredge fine, medium & coarse sand, silt, mud etc and admixture of said solids. The cutter suction dredgers will have to be delivered at any of the port of MMB, which will be intimated while issuing techno-commercial work order. The main objective of designing such type of dredger is to provide dredging facility in the small port, fisheries harbor etc where maximum draft available ranges from 1 to1.5 m. GENERAL DESCRIPTION OF DREDGERS 200 CUM CAPACITY The supplier has to design the dredger to get the output i.e. Solid 200 cum per hr solid as desired by MMB. The dredgers will be dismountable cutter suction dredger and non propelled. The agency will design the dredgers in such a manner that it can be easily and quickly assembled and dismantled in simple manner. The cutter, spuds and side winches will be hydraulically driven through separate motor and suitable gear box. A provision for box coolers for the system will be made at suitable places. The above mentioned machineries will be mounted in and on the main pontoon so that minimum number of equipments/parts has to be dismantled while transporting the dredger through road. The dimensions of dredger & equipments will be so kept that it can be loaded easily & safely in low bed Indian make Trailers for transportation purpose through road. The Marine diesel engine for dredge pump & other equipments/machineries will be remote operated for low, idle and maximum continuous speed so that one man can operate the dredger from dredge master's cabin. Dredger to be suitable for dredging up to a maximum of 6 meters dredging depth with output of approx. 200 cubic meters per hour of fine sand over a distance of 500 meters with a 3 m terminal elevation at an in situ density of 1.9specific gravity. a) b) c) d) Approximate dimension of the dredge to be approx. 15 to 18 M length overall x 3 to 4 M breadth overall x 3 M height (without spuds, spud hoists and muffler) Fuel capacity of approximately 4 cubic meters to be provided. The dredger should be transportable on one truck with low boy trailer. design and drawing of dredger are to be by classified society and all equipments and pipes etc. are approved by standard institutions.

Dredger to be complete in all respects in line with the MMB to fulfill all description / specifications suitable for dredging up to a maximum of 6 meters dredging depth with output of approx. 200 cubic meters per hour of medium sand over a distance of 500 meters with a 3 m terminal elevation at an in situ density of 1.9 specific gravity. The Supplier is requested to quote the firm price. The Maharashtra Maritime Board do not favour offers subject to price variation clause. If some parts of the equipment is imported by the supplier and the quoted prices of such equipment is variable with exchange rate, the Bidders shall intimate the C.I.F value of such parts in foreign currency, duties leviable. However, while calculating comparative cost, B.C. (Buyers Credit) selling exchange rate published by the State Bank of India for the day on which tenders were opened, will be taken. However, any variation in B.C (Buyers Credit) selling exchange rate upto the date of award of contract will also be taken into account while deciding the case. In the absence of any price variation clause the prices will be treated as firm. The currency selected for converting tender prices to a common base for the purpose of evaluation and comparison is Indian Rupees. The basis for such conversion will be the B.C (Buyers Credit) selling exchange rate established by State Bank of India. The exchange rate applicable would be prevailing as on the date of opening of tender. Any Duties, Taxes, & Levies shall be paid by the Supplier and Income Tax and VAT will be deducted from the bills of the supplier as per rules. Liquidated Damages: If the supplier fails to abide by the provisions of clause Delivery Date he shall be liable to pay penalty charges @ 0.5% per week or part thereof the contract value of such portion of material as has not been delivered within the Delivery Period subject to a maximum of 5 % of contract value.

2.29

Force Majeure: The supplier shall not be liable for any penalty charges due to delay in manufacture or delivery of material resulting from any causes beyond the suppliers reasonable control including but not limited to the compliance with regulations, orders or instruction of central/State of Municipal Govt. or agency thereto, acts of God, acts of Civil & Military authorities, fires, floods, freight embargoes, war risks, riots and civil commotions. The supplier will seek extension of delivery period within two weeks of occurrence of any such event and clearly state the anticipated delay in supply on account of such an event/ events. On receipt of such a request from the supplier, extension in delivery period may be granted for the period for which the completion of work is proved by the supplier to have been delayed for circumstances covered by reasons of Force Majeure. subject to further condition if the delivery period is likely to be extended by more than 60 days on account of any event, the
